Merge branch 'attribute_access' into release
[philo.git] / docs / models / nodes-and-views.rst
1 Nodes and Views: Building Website structure
2 ===========================================
3 .. automodule:: philo.models.nodes
4
5 Nodes
6 -----
7
8 .. autoclass:: Node
9         :show-inheritance:
10         :members:
11         :exclude-members: attribute_set
12
13 Views
14 -----
15
16 Abstract View Models
17 ++++++++++++++++++++
18
19 .. autoclass:: View
20         :show-inheritance:
21         :members:
22         :exclude-members: attribute_set
23
24 .. autoclass:: MultiView
25         :show-inheritance:
26         :members:
27         :exclude-members: attribute_set
28
29 Concrete View Subclasses
30 ++++++++++++++++++++++++
31
32 .. autoclass:: Redirect
33         :show-inheritance:
34         :members:
35         :exclude-members: attribute_set
36
37 .. autoclass:: File
38         :show-inheritance:
39         :members:
40         :exclude-members: attribute_set
41
42 Pages
43 *****
44
45 .. automodule:: philo.models.pages
46
47 .. autoclass:: Page
48         :members:
49         :exclude-members: attribute_set
50         :show-inheritance:
51
52 .. autoclass:: Template
53         :members:
54         :show-inheritance:
55
56 .. autoclass:: Contentlet
57         :members:
58
59 .. autoclass:: ContentReference
60         :members: